(PartiallyPolitics.com) – Former President Trump has long been claiming that the federal investigation into his alleged mishandling of classified materials was politically motivated and has claimed that it is a “witch hunt.” These are allegations that he reiterated after being indicted on 37 federal charges in connection to this probe.

On Friday, the indictment was unsealed revealing the 37 counts, which include obstruction of justice and 31 counts of willful retention of classified documents in violation of the Espionage Act. Trump has defended himself arguing that he acted in the same way that all presidents before him had. He also repeatedly stated that President Biden has not faced any charges even though classified documents were found in his possession.

In a Truth Social post on June 8, Trump had written that he was informed of his indictment over the “Boxes Hoax.” He proceeded to state that Biden had “1850 Boxes at the University of Delaware” and other boxes in Chinatown, D.C., and his parking garage. The “1850 Boxes” specifically are meant to be a reference to Biden’s documents from his time as Senator but those documents are not classified and the National Archives do not require Senators to return all documents when they leave office.

However, the President is required to return all documents, something that Trump allegedly willfully refused to do after leaving the White House in 2021. President Biden is also being investigated for the classified documents found in his house by Special Counsel Robert Hur. Not a lot of information has been revealed about the probe into Biden’s case.
